Paul's Story

You might remember I have a twin brother named Peter. I live in Dedham, MA since 1987 and have a wife and two boys ages 12 and 22 (as of 2016). I am a Certified Financial Planner and Financial Consultant for 20 years (since 1996). Since I completed college I have always held sales positions. Like many from Needham High School, I graduated from UMASS Amherst and was a Marketing Major in the School of Business. My oldest boy also graduated from UMASS Amherst 35 years after I did. I expect my other boy to go to college when I am about 64. In my Junior year of college, I was an exchange student at the University of Oregon in Eugene. Dennis Joyce, also in the Needham High School class of 1977 was at that school that same year and lived on my floor. I always thought he was a good guy. We both use to caddy at Wellesley Country Club as teenagers. I have traveled throughout the United States. Just out of college, I spent a month in Europe with my twin brother with a Eurail (train) pass and staying in mostly youth hostels and bed and breakfasts. One of my best trips happened when I was 25 when I traveled to Scotland for ten days and played some great golf courses. While I have broken 80 about three times, I think shooting an 89 at the Old Course at St. Andrews in Scotland was a bigger accomplishment. I really enjoyed taking my son who was 10 at the time to game one of the World Series in Boston in 2004. That was the same year my other son was born and my father died from Alzeimer disease. I tell my family that if I ever get to a point where I am drooling in a bucket and I no longer recognize them, I have but one request. "Don't put a Yankees cap on my head!" These days I like to play my piano and also listen to music. I would have to say that I like the music of the 80's the best. I donate blood platelets about every two weeks and am currently at 105 donations. I hope to get to 600 or more donations. I am not sharing this to brag or to make you think I am special. I'm not. It's just that I'm not self centered like I was back in high school. I'm also more self confident than I was in high school. In high school and throughout my adult life I have had many acquaintances but few really good close friends. My regrets include not keeping in touch with the true friends I have known and not being nicer/respectful to people that I have met. A quick story that you might appreciate. Sometime around 1985, a friend of mine from Junior High school (Pollard) and High School, Donald Frazer died of cancer. After high school I had not kept in touch with him. When he died I couldn't make the wake or funeral because I was traveling to California. So I wrote to the family and talked about how we used to go fishing at the Polaroid pond off of Kendrick St. Some days we used worms and some days we used corn. I wrote that I still remember how Don laughed the day he opened a can of corn and it turned out to be creamed corn. About 10 years or so after I wrote that letter I was at St. Barthomew's church in Needham and met Don's younger sister. She recognized me as the Schofield that wrote that letter and said her family cried when they read it. In high school I was friends with Danny Kaufman. I remember that he had to deal with his mother trying to commit suicide. High school was tough for many of us. This must have been really tough to deal with. I wish I could find out how he is doing. While I went to many of the early reunions (10, 15 and 20 I think) I haven't been to any in at least the last ten years because I didn't know about them. I expect the 40th which should be coming up in the Fall of 2017 will probably be at the Needham Golf course. I plan to go and hope to see many of the people I knew from growing up in Needham.
